How Medicare Advantage Plans Work

Medicare Advantage plans combine hospital and medical coverage into one plan and are offered by private insurance companies approved by Medicare.

  • May include prescription drug coverage
  • Often include additional benefits such as dental or vision
  • Usually require using provider networks
  • May require referrals for specialists

Medicare Advantage vs Medicare Supplement

Many Florida retirees compare Medicare Advantage with Medicare Supplement (Medigap) plans.

  • Medicare Advantage often uses provider networks
  • Medicare Supplement allows broader provider access
  • Medicare Advantage may have lower premiums but higher out-of-pocket costs
  • Medicare Supplement often offers more predictable costs
